What Pressure Washing Should Target Before A Listing

The best prep work begins by looking at where dirt, algae, and oxidation actually collect.

Concrete holds grime well, especially in shaded spots, and one pass can make the whole front approach look fresher.

Siding is next, but it should be cleaned with care.

Timing, Curb Appeal, And Common Mistakes

Timing matters more than many homeowners expect.

That gives the exterior a fresh look when it matters most, while still leaving room to handle any last-minute touch-ups.

High pressure is useful on some hard surfaces, but it can etch softer materials, damage paint, or force water into vulnerable areas if used carelessly.

Plan to move furniture, potted plants, fragile decor, and vehicles away from spray zones so the cleaning can be done evenly and efficiently.
